‘Dejected’ LA Knight breaks silence with a three-word message after heartbreaking title loss at Survivor Series: WarGames

LA Knight, who is known as The MegaStar of WWE, recently dropped his United States Championship at The Survivor Series Premium Live Event. Shinsuke Nakamura had only just returned to the ring some weeks ago and attacked him on an episode of SmackDown, which set up the match. The loss came as a shock to everyone considering the winning streak that Knight was on. He was regularly defending his championship in open challenges and even on PLEs. It reminded the fans of the John Cena US Open Challenge era.

After his 119-day title reign came to an end, Knight put out a tweet on his social media that signifies his determination to reclaim the title. His message has hinted towards what might be next for him. The tweet also had the caption ” … to be continued.”
